Can you get around Niagara Falls without a car?

The city of Niagara Falls provides a city-wide public transit bus system that runs seven days a week – with reduced service on Sundays. You can find a route map here and locate your nearest bus stop here. Exact fare (in Canadian dollars) is required when purchasing on the bus.

What is the most common form of transportation?

car
According to Statista’s Global Consumer Survey, 76 percent of American commuters use their own car to move between home and work, making it by far the most popular mode of transportation. Meanwhile, only 11 percent of the 5,649 respondents use public transportation while 10 percent ride their bike.

How can I get around Canada without a car?

Canada’s major cities have excellent public transport systems, with a mixture of buses, trams, light rail systems and underground trains. If you’re visiting Toronto, Vancouver, Montreal or Ottawa, you can easily get around without a car.

What kind of transportation do they use in Canada?

Canada has excellent transportation connections, with the well-developed road, rail, aviation, bus, and ferry networks connecting towns and cities across the country. Buses, subways, and trains are among the several types of transportation available in major cities across the country and for local travel.

    Is there a shuttle from Buffalo Airport to Niagara Falls?

    Buffalo Airport Shuttle to Niagara Falls (Canada) 45.2 miles. 38 mins. One-way – $65.00 per person. Round trip – $130.00 per person. There is also one-way flat rate available (for up to 6 passengers) to Niagara Falls (USA) for $70.00 and to Niagara Falls in Canada for $85.00.
